Patty Lou Glover Obituary

Patty Lou Glover, 80, of Friendsville, MD, died Wednesday, January 26, 2022, at Ruby Memorial Hospital, Morgantown, WV.

Born June 1, 1941, in Sang Run, MD, she was the daughter of the late Claude H. and Mildred (Rodeheaver) Cuppett. She was also preceded in death by one son, Jeffery and one daughter Tina Margroff.

Ms. Glover was the County Treasurer for the Garrett County Government, having been elected in 1986 and retiring in 2004 after 30+ years of service. She was a member of the Oak Grove Church of the Brethren, where she was treasurer for many years and a member of the Northern Garrett County Rescue Squad.
